Camas is 8-2 against Skyview since May of 2022 and they'll have a chance to extend that dominance on Monday. The Papermakers are taking a road trip to face off against the Storm at 4:30 p.m. Camas will be strutting in after a victory while Skyview will be coming in after a defeat.
Having struggled with five losses in a row, Camas turned things around against Union on Thursday. They had just enough and edged out the Titans 3-2. The game was the first time the Papermakers have beaten the Titans on their field since April 18, 2024.
Meanwhile, Skyview fell victim to Battle Ground and their airtight pitching crew on Thursday. They lost 6-0 to the Tigers. The Storm have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Skyview now has a losing record of 7-8. As for Camas, the win got them back to even at 8-8.
Camas got the 'W' when the teams last played back in May of 2025 against Skyview by a conclusive 8-1 score. The rematch might be a little tougher for the Papermakers since the squad won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
